Transaction 717680489692b83e0021ea40ada4fca4b29f744b5277a007f2a44a3ee25e2b5a

1 Input
2 Outputs
  • 717680489692b83e0021ea40ada4fca4b29f744b5277a007f2a44a3ee25e2b5a:0
  • value  603342
    address  16EMZwHyWSBzPWTHPJvuhFrYSmcDnrQpWZ
  • 717680489692b83e0021ea40ada4fca4b29f744b5277a007f2a44a3ee25e2b5a:1
  • value  1244452
    address  15QnJQCo4CSTbJJBKKMdNAeSrGCCVTfQNx